(Variable Length Register Slice)是一种用于存储和处理数据的硬件电路元件。它可以根据需要动态调整存储数据的位数,提供了灵活性和效率。
可变长度寄存器片可以根据输入信号的长度自动调整其内部寄存器的位数。这使得它可以适应不同长度的数据,并且可以在不浪费硬件资源的情况下实现高效的数据存储和处理。
优势:
- 灵活性:可变长度寄存器片可以根据需要动态调整存储数据的位数,适应不同长度的数据。
- 节省资源:由于可变长度寄存器片可以根据输入信号的长度调整位数,因此可以避免浪费硬件资源。
- 高效性:可变长度寄存器片可以实现高效的数据存储和处理,提高系统的性能。
应用场景:
- 数据存储:可变长度寄存器片可以用于存储不同长度的数据,例如传感器数据、图像数据等。
- 数据处理:可变长度寄存器片可以用于对不同长度的数据进行处理,例如数据压缩、加密解密等。
- 状态机设计:可变长度寄存器片可以用于实现状态机的状态存储和转换。
腾讯云相关产品:
腾讯云提供了一系列云计算产品,其中与Verilog中的可变长度寄存器片相关的产品包括:
- 腾讯云FPGA云服务器:提供了可编程逻辑门阵列(FPGA)资源,可以用于实现硬件加速和定制化计算,包括可变长度寄存器片的设计和开发。
- 腾讯云弹性MapReduce:提供了弹性的大数据处理服务,可以用于对大规模数据进行处理和分析,包括对可变长度寄存器片的应用。
产品介绍链接地址:
- 腾讯云FPGA云服务器:https://cloud.tencent.com/product/fpga
- 腾讯云弹性MapReduce:https://cloud.tencent.com/product/emr